Transaction 5b3bc25d83229a907250eec05ad5256d0765bf6cde58c44e8b55de8c0c05b33b
1 Input
1 Output
-
5b3bc25d83229a907250eec05ad5256d0765bf6cde58c44e8b55de8c0c05b33b:0
- value
- 62687
- script pubkey
- OP_0 OP_PUSHBYTES_20 85ff811ba8b6439bb0dabf216eb3b265ef154b86
- address
- bc1qshlczxagkepehvx6huskavajvhh32juxsk84ey